It is permitted in the Borough of Ingram for owners of private property to park or store upon their own property pleasure motor vehicles (motor homes) or pleasure towed vehicles (travel trailers) or boats with trailers, all not exceeding 35 feet in length, if owned by the said property owner. The parking and storage of such vehicles is further subject to the requirements of Chapter
175, Vehicles, Abandoned or Junked. Parking or storing of such vehicles in residential districts is restricted to side yards or rear yards only.
Any person, firm or corporation violating any
of the provisions of this chapter will be issued a notice of violation
from the Code Enforcement Officer, and, upon failure of the property
owner to comply within 15 days of notice, then a citation will be
issued by the District Justice thereof. Any person, firm, or corporation
violating any provision of this chapter shall, upon conviction before
any District Justice, be fined in accordance with the penalties set
forth in the Pennsylvania State Motor Vehicle Code.
